Summer rock concert announced for Tisdale

Jan 16, 2018 | 7:00 AM

Children of the ‘70s and ‘80s could be flocking to Tisdale this summer for a major musical event.

The Tisdale and District Chamber of Commerce has announced the lineup for Rockin’ The Square concert this coming July. Nick Gilder and Sweeney Todd will perform along with Glass Tiger and Rick Emmett from Triumph.

Ivan Allan is with the concert’s organizing committee. He is already predicting a good turnout.

“Last year we sold out, so this year I think it’s going to go fast,” he said. “We had never sold out before so people were thinking they could just come and they showed up at the gate, but we had to turn them away.”

Rockin’ The Square is now in its 11th year. The theme of the concert has always been classic rock which Allan admits is not by accident.

“It’s a week before Craven so not a good time to be pulling out county [music] and I am not a country guy,” he said.

Downtown Tisdale will be transformed for the concert on July 6 which Allan said is part of what makes the event so “magical.”

Tickets are $60 and are available through the Tisdale Chamber office.
